libscratchcpp
A library for C++ based Scratch project players
Loading...
Searching...
No Matches
libscratchcpp::Stage Member List
This is the complete list of members for
libscratchcpp::Stage
, including all inherited members.
addBlock
(std::shared_ptr< Block > block)
libscratchcpp::Target
addComment
(std::shared_ptr< Comment > comment)
libscratchcpp::Target
addCostume
(std::shared_ptr< Costume > costume)
libscratchcpp::Target
addList
(std::shared_ptr< List > list)
libscratchcpp::Target
addSound
(std::shared_ptr< Sound > sound)
libscratchcpp::Target
addVariable
(std::shared_ptr< Variable > variable)
libscratchcpp::Target
blockAt
(int index) const
libscratchcpp::Target
blocks
() const
libscratchcpp::Target
boundingRect
() const override
libscratchcpp::Stage
virtual
bubble
()
libscratchcpp::Target
bubble
() const
libscratchcpp::Target
clearGraphicsEffects
() override
libscratchcpp::Stage
virtual
clearSoundEffects
()
libscratchcpp::Target
virtual
commentAt
(int index) const
libscratchcpp::Target
comments
() const
libscratchcpp::Target
costumeAt
(int index) const
libscratchcpp::Target
costumeIndex
() const
libscratchcpp::Target
costumes
() const
libscratchcpp::Target
currentCostume
() const
libscratchcpp::Target
currentCostumeHeight
() const override
libscratchcpp::Stage
virtual
currentCostumeWidth
() const override
libscratchcpp::Stage
virtual
dataSource
() const
libscratchcpp::Target
inline
protected
virtual
Drawable
()
libscratchcpp::Drawable
Drawable
(const Drawable &)=delete
libscratchcpp::Drawable
engine
() const
libscratchcpp::Drawable
fastBoundingRect
() const override
libscratchcpp::Stage
virtual
findBlock
(const std::string &id) const
libscratchcpp::Target
findComment
(const std::string &id) const
libscratchcpp::Target
findCostume
(const std::string &costumeName) const
libscratchcpp::Target
findList
(const std::string &listName) const
libscratchcpp::Target
findListById
(const std::string &id) const
libscratchcpp::Target
findSound
(const std::string &soundName) const
libscratchcpp::Target
findVariable
(const std::string &variableName) const
libscratchcpp::Target
findVariableById
(const std::string &id) const
libscratchcpp::Target
getInterface
() const
libscratchcpp::Stage
graphicsEffectValue
(IGraphicsEffect *effect) const
libscratchcpp::Target
greenFlagBlocks
() const
libscratchcpp::Target
isStage
() const override
libscratchcpp::Stage
virtual
isTarget
() const override final
libscratchcpp::Target
virtual
isTextBubble
() const
libscratchcpp::Drawable
inline
virtual
layerOrder
() const
libscratchcpp::Drawable
layerOrderChanged
() const
libscratchcpp::Drawable
listAt
(int index) const
libscratchcpp::Target
listData
()
libscratchcpp::Target
lists
() const
libscratchcpp::Target
name
() const
libscratchcpp::Target
setCostumeIndex
(int newCostumeIndex) override
libscratchcpp::Stage
virtual
setEngine
(IEngine *engine) override final
libscratchcpp::Target
virtual
setGraphicsEffectValue
(IGraphicsEffect *effect, double value) override
libscratchcpp::Stage
virtual
setInterface
(IStageHandler *newInterface)
libscratchcpp::Stage
setLayerOrder
(int newLayerOrder)
libscratchcpp::Drawable
virtual
setName
(const std::string &name)
libscratchcpp::Target
setSoundEffectValue
(Sound::Effect effect, double value)
libscratchcpp::Target
virtual
setTempo
(int newTempo)
libscratchcpp::Stage
setTextToSpeechLanguage
(const std::string &newTextToSpeechLanguage)
libscratchcpp::Stage
setVideoState
(VideoState newVideoState)
libscratchcpp::Stage
setVideoState
(const std::string &newVideoState)
libscratchcpp::Stage
setVideoState
(const char *newVideoState)
libscratchcpp::Stage
setVideoTransparency
(int newVideoTransparency)
libscratchcpp::Stage
setVolume
(double newVolume)
libscratchcpp::Target
soundAt
(int index) const
libscratchcpp::Target
soundEffectValue
(Sound::Effect effect) const
libscratchcpp::Target
virtual
sounds
() const
libscratchcpp::Target
Stage
()
libscratchcpp::Stage
Stage
(const Stage &)=delete
libscratchcpp::Stage
Target
()
libscratchcpp::Target
Target
(const Target &)=delete
libscratchcpp::Target
tempo
() const
libscratchcpp::Stage
textToSpeechLanguage
() const
libscratchcpp::Stage
touchingColor
(Rgb color) const override
libscratchcpp::Stage
virtual
touchingColor
(Rgb color, Rgb mask) const override
libscratchcpp::Stage
virtual
touchingEdge
() const
libscratchcpp::Target
touchingPoint
(double x, double y) const override
libscratchcpp::Stage
virtual
touchingSprite
(Sprite *sprite) const
libscratchcpp::Target
variableAt
(int index) const
libscratchcpp::Target
variableData
()
libscratchcpp::Target
variables
() const
libscratchcpp::Target
VideoState
enum name
libscratchcpp::Stage
videoState
() const
libscratchcpp::Stage
videoStateStr
() const
libscratchcpp::Stage
videoTransparency
() const
libscratchcpp::Stage
volume
() const
libscratchcpp::Target
~Target
()
libscratchcpp::Target
virtual
Generated by
1.13.2